In May 2021, Maggie celebrated her 60th birthday with a profound sense of optimism, believing it would be the best year of her life. However, a series of peculiar symptoms — including ocular migraines, a blood clot in her leg, and vision problems — soon derailed those plans. Following a misread EKG and a persistent cardiologist appointment, a CT scan eventually revealed stage 4 non-small cell lung cancer (NSCLC) with metastases in the brain. Despite the devastating news, Maggie’s narrative shifted from a fear of immediate decline to a focus on scientific advancement when a blood biopsy identified an EGFR mutation.

Maggie M. feature profile

The emotional turning point of Maggie’s experience occurred when she realized that cancer treatment is not one size fits all. Initially expecting the carpet-bombing approach of traditional chemotherapy, she was instead prescribed a targeted therapy pill that led to no evidence of disease (NED) within just two months. This revelation transformed her from an overwhelmed patient into a dedicated advocate who views her scans as vital information rather than sources of terror.

Over the last four and a half years, Maggie has navigated five lines of treatment, utilizing repeated biomarker testing to identify new resistance mutations like MET amplification and MET overexpression. Her experience highlights the critical role of genomic testing in accessing cutting-edge therapies, some of which were FDA-approved only a year ago.

Today, Maggie remains focused on the blue sky behind the clouds, using her voice to humanize the statistics for drug companies and providing peer support to those newly diagnosed.

From birthday optimism to a shocking stage 4 lung cancer diagnosis 

In May 2021, I turned 60 years old. I remember waking up on my birthday and having this feeling that this is going to be the best year of my life. I don’t always feel that on my birthday, but I remember feeling that on my 60th.

About a month and a half later, I had an ocular migraine while I was working. There was no pain involved. It’s like looking through a kaleidoscope with white glass and typically lasts 30 seconds or a minute in one eye and maybe the other. I Googled “kaleidoscope vision” because I remembered experiencing something similar a few years before. Sure enough, it was an ocular migraine. I talked to my optometrist about it several years ago and learned it can be brought on by stress. It was a stressful time at work because we were getting ready for an audit, so I didn’t think anything about it.

Then, a couple of weeks later, I had this pain in my leg after standing up and it didn’t go away. I thought it was a muscle cramp. It turned out to be a partial blood clot in my leg. I continued to have weird symptoms. This was around June and July.

I had other vision problems. I was referred to an ophthalmologist who ran a bunch of tests, including a complete blood count (CBC). The white and red counts were off, but nothing that would raise any big red flags. In the meantime, my optometrist suggested I get a physical because I was having all these weird symptoms, so I made an appointment to see my primary care physician (PCP) at the beginning of August.

A couple of days before the appointment, I experienced pain on the left side of my chest and then again a couple of days later. I mentioned it at my PCP appointment, so they did an EKG. The results indicated some abnormality with my heart rhythm, so I was referred to a cardiologist with an appointment for a couple of weeks out. In the meantime, I got a message from my PCP’s office that either the machine had made a mistake or somebody had misread the results. There was nothing wrong with my heart rhythm, so I didn’t need to see a cardiologist. But I decided to keep the appointment.

I explained to the physician’s assistant in cardiology what had been going on that summer: the vision and balance problems, the deep vein thrombosis (DVT) in my leg, and the pain in my chest. She thought I could be developing a pulmonary embolism, even though I was on blood thinners. She ordered a CT scan and an ECG.

I had the CT scan on August 31st at 8:00 a.m. and got the results in my health portal by 9:30 a.m. Of course, I opened it and immediately read words like “metastases.” I thought, “Wait, what? What’s going on?” I was able to get in to see my PCP at the end of the day. My PCP and the PA in cardiology were very apologetic that I got the results before they had a chance to tell me. I asked my PCP, “What are the chances that this isn’t cancer?” She said, “There’s about a 1% chance that it’s not cancer.”

A subsequent biopsy confirmed that it was non-small cell lung carcinoma. I had a brain MRI that found metastases in my brain, which were causing the vision and balance problems. I never had any lung symptoms, so it was shocking to me to have lung cancer. Of all the cancers to get, it was a complete shock.

Originally, before they found the brain mets, they thought it might be stage 3 cancer. I remember seeing a thoracic surgeon first, thinking I could have surgery. But then they did the brain MRI, so it was now stage 4. In my extended family, nobody had lung cancer, but there were people who have had stage 4 cancer and didn’t live very long. I thought all cancer was the same. I thought, “Stage 4. Okay, it’s September, I’ll get chemotherapy and lose all my hair, then I’ll be dead by Christmas.”

Surprisingly, that’s when I first learned that cancer wasn’t one-size-fits-all. My oncologist fortunately ordered a blood biopsy, which is how I found out that I had an EGFR mutation and that there was a targeted therapy pill I could take. I started taking that pill in October and by December, scans showed that there was no evidence of disease anywhere. There was nothing in my brain and my lungs.

Going back to the pain on the left side of my chest, there was no cancer there. The cancer was in my right lung and right lymph nodes. I never had that pain again. I take it as a sign from above, as if somebody was shaking me, “Maggie, come on. You need to get this tested.” I’m absolutely grateful for a machine that made a mistake.

My treatment journey through five lines of therapy

My targeted therapy resulted in no evidence of disease after two months. I stayed that way from January through September 2022. Then a scan in September showed that the cancer had come back at the original tumor site, which was in my upper right lobe. One of the options was radiation or stereotactic body radiation therapy (SBRT). I had a cruise planned over Thanksgiving, so the radiation had to get done in November before my cruise, which thankfully worked out. Doctors are so accommodating. I find all the cancer doctors are wonderful.

In the spring of 2023, another scan showed some more progression. My oncologist ordered another blood biopsy and also a tissue biopsy from my lung tissue. The blood biopsy came back and showed that I had developed a resistance mutation: MET amplification. This can happen a lot of times for EGFR patients who are on tyrosine kinase inhibitors (TKIs). It’s a resistance mutation that develops.

What was fortuitous was that the clinic I was going to happened to have a phase 2 clinical trial that was opening up and accepting new patients for people in my exact situation: EGFR patients who had progressed on a TKI because of MET amplification. I went on that clinical trial. I was in the control group, so I stayed on the targeted therapy for EGFR and added a targeted therapy drug for the MET amplification. That treatment regimen worked for nine months. It seems I could go in nine-month intervals.

Then a scan showed the cancer had come back. The site had grown more than 20 or 25%, whatever the cutoff was for the trial, so I got dropped from the trial. I had some more SBRT. More scans in the summer of 2024 showed more progression.

The next option was chemotherapy. On World Cancer Day, August 1, 2024, I started chemotherapy. I did six rounds of platinum-based therapy and some more rounds of the other chemo drug alone.

Then in January 2025, a scan showed progression again. The chemo had worked for a while. I had stayed on the targeted therapy pill. Blood biopsies, since the first one in 2023, have never shown MET amplification. But I’ve had tissue biopsies from lymph nodes and those showed that I still had the MET amplification in addition to EGFR. My doctors knew that we needed to treat both mutations in order to be successful in pushing back the cancer.

I was on combined drugs for the MET amplification and a different drug for the EGFR mutation from March through October 2025. But one of the typical side effects of the drug for the MET mutation is edema. I ended up getting severe edema in my lungs as pleural effusion, so I had to have thoracentesis procedures to remove fluid. I was short of breath all the time. The side effect of the drug outweighed the benefit. It was working, but it was just outweighing the benefit, so I had to stop treatment. That was my fourth line.

Recently, I started my fifth line. Another test that my oncologist did was immunohistochemistry (IHC) testing. You do a FISH test to get the MET amplification result, and you can do IHC, which tests for overexpression. In addition to amplification, I also have MET overexpression. It’s a double-edged sword in a way, but this one opened up a new line of treatment, a new drug that will work better for me because it targets the overexpression. I’m going on that and then back on another drug to target the EGFR mutation.

I’ve gotten used to seeing progression in my scans. I look at scans as information. I used to get freaked out by them, but not so much anymore. If something is going on, it’s going to help direct my oncology team and me to figure out the next line of treatment, and I’m always hopeful that there will be a next step.

Why biomarker testing is critical for every lung cancer patient

Biomarker testing is critical for getting patients the right treatment, especially for lung cancer. It’s not one-size-fits-all. It’s not just chemo for everyone. You have to know what your biomarkers are. You have to get genomic testing, next-generation sequencing (NGS), and RNA and DNA testing, because there are drugs out there that have been developed to target specific mutations. If you have a specific mutation, then you can get access to the drug that’s going to work for you.

It’s not throwing everything at it and hoping something will stick; it’s a dart. It’s a little missile attacking your mutation. I have this analogy in my head. The cancer cells are like sleeper cells, the little spies that look like everyone else. They come into a town, and everybody accepts them. They’re a little bit different, but they seem fine. Then suddenly, these sleeper cells get activated and they start killing the other cells in the town.

The first method of attack can be chemotherapy, which I consider like carpet bombing. You’re killing those sleeper cells, but you’re also killing everybody else. But then you’ve got the SEAL team that comes in, the snipers. That’s what the targeted therapies are like. Those are drugs that go in like little missiles and target those cancer cells, leaving the healthy cells alone. The healthy cells can still live and thrive in your body, but the cancer cells will be gone.

What I learned about biomarkers and personalized medicine

Biomarkers allow for personalized medicine. It’s about finding the right treatment for that patient at the right time. Any time I’ve had progression, I’ve either asked for a blood biopsy. It had been a year since I had a tissue biopsy, so I asked my oncologist, “Can we do another tissue biopsy?” Tissue biopsies are the gold standard to find out what’s going on with the cancer. A blood biopsy is only as good as what happens to be circulating in your bloodstream at the time.

It’s about personalized medicine and tailoring the treatment to the patient. The patient and the oncologist need to be able to work together and come to an agreement on what that treatment will be. Educating myself on what drugs are important for what treatment and what drugs are for what biomarker is critical.

Recently, I was going to go on a drug for the MET overexpression, and I asked about a drug for EGFR. Initially, my oncologist said, “The drug for overexpression has some chemotherapy with it, so it should be able to take care of the other mutation.” I remembered reading something and talking with another oncologist in the past, so I reached out to that other oncologist, who then directed me to a clinical trial that had been done. In that trial, people who had MET overexpression and EGFR did better if they were on drugs for both mutations. I was able to look at the clinical trial results and cite results from that study back to my oncologist. I brought that information to my oncologist and he agreed. Now I’ll be on drugs for both mutations.

My advice for patients who don’t know about biomarker testing

Some of the different lung cancer groups have information on their websites about biomarker testing. Where I learned about it was the Lung Cancer Research Foundation. They have done webinars and past webinars are available on their website. There is one where they talked about biomarker testing and next-generation sequencing, the importance of tissue testing, and the kinds of tests to get for biomarkers.

Definitely ask your oncologist. If your oncologist isn’t doing biomarker testing, then you need to ask for it. There are different blood biopsy companies that do biomarker testing. Though tissue testing is still the gold standard, sometimes it’s difficult to get enough tissue samples. If you’re lucky, like me, to have lymph nodes that are easy to reach, where they can get more tissue, those are great for biomarker testing.

You won’t know what treatment you need without biomarker testing, even to know if you don’t have a biomarker. In addition to biomarkers, there’s PD-L1 and that can direct treatment, too. If you have a higher PD-L1 number, you might be more of a candidate for immunotherapy than someone with low PD-L1 numbers. These are important things to know that can direct your treatment as a new patient. Without that information, it’s like throwing a dart in the dark.
